Description
Provision of GP Out of Hours services for West Yorkshire population and associated services including 2 Leeds Urgent Treatment Centres. The service provides GP OOH services, as applicable during an out of hours period, to patients registered in West Yorkshire where it would not be reasonable for the patient to wait for the services to be available from their registered GP practice during opening hours.
Total Quantity or Scope
The Contract Authority; NHS West Yorkshire Integrated Care Board intends to award a contract to an existing provider following Direct Award Process C. The authority is publishing this notice in Find a Tender in accordance with the NHS Provider Selection Regime.Contract will commence on 1 April 2026 with a term of 2 Years. The Contract value will be £58,248,998.

Legal Justification
This is a Provider Selection Regime (PSR) intention to award notice. The awarding of this contract is subject to the Health Care Services (Provider Selection Regime) Regulations 2023. For the avoidance of doubt, the provisions of the Public Contracts Regulations 2015 do not apply to this award. The publication of this notice marks the start of the Standstill Period. Representations by providers must be made to the relevant authority by 20 March 2026. This contract has not yet formally been awarded; this notice serves as an intention to award a contract under the PSR.’
